The Gateway Arch is referred to “The Gateway to the West” or “St. Louis Arch” is the most iconic structure in the St. Louis skyline guy. The Gateway Arch is 630 feet high and built from stainless steel and is the tallest man-made monument in the Western Hemisphere. The Gateway Arch is the most popular attraction in St. Louis with approximately 2.06 million visitors in 2019! The monument opened to the public in 1967 and took over two years to build. The cost of construction was 13 million dollars in 1965 which is around $85 million dollars today!

For the best experience possible, Elite Sports Tours suggests  taking a Tram Ride to the top of the Arch. This is a unique experience that will allow you see everything The Gateway Arch has to offer. You will enjoy stunning views 30 miles to the west and east! The entire tram tour is around 45-60 minutes. If heights aren’t your thing, you can experience The Gateway Arch from the water!
